Service: Super Slow, (place wasn't full) It took them around 5 minutes to be ready to sit me inside (where it's definitely too small, and awkward when someone walks into the toilet). Chef/Cooker's service/attitude can definitely improve. Waiter was incredibly welcoming though and attentive. Conclusion do try to avoid sitting inside.
Food: -Taco de Asada: Meat was flavourless and the whole grill experience doesn't really work when the meat is tasteless. -Taco Taurino: Combinination just didn't really work for me, poor texture and lack of quality in the ingredients = nothing really to remember, not worth waiting for them to prepare another one. -Volcan de Asada: Again, same problem as the Taco de Asada, although you can find more flavour due to the addition of the mashed beans bed and the flavour of the "toasted" maiz tortilla, but again not from the meat. -Taco vegetariano: This one has more personality, I'd definitely change the gouda cheese to something less intrusive that blends better with the huitlacoche rather than stealing the spotlight, I did order another one of these. Waiter told me all about the weekend special and it sounded really good, unfortunately o5 wasn't ready yet to be served (place had been open for a good couple of hours).
Salsas: Green and "Molcajeteada" both actually pretty good Tortillas: Maiz is standard I was expecting something more handcrafted, Harina same thing and lack flavour
I paid $380 aprox for the tacos and 2 sparkling waters, but left hungry :(
